Letters to the Editor
Sir, This is with reference to the news that the Government will say `no' to troops for Iraq, even if the U.N. mandates it ( Sep. 6 ). But the Government should study the U.N. resolution in its entirety and evolve a national consensus, before announcing its decision. The present global context gives an excellent opportunity to India to take the initiative and work with countries like France and Germany to draft a new U.N. resolution on Iraq. With a substantial clout among the Arab countries, India should utilise the opportunity to take up a leadership role in defining a new world order.
Murali Swaminathan,
